In Tiger when I wanted to make icons of a folder I used a little script called ‘Icon Creator’. It didnt work anymore in Leopard. While experimenting I discovered a very fun and easy way to make icons in Leopard.

All you have to do is to open a jpeg (I believe any format that will open works) in PREVIEW.

Then (with the selection tool) you select the part of the picture you want as your icon. Now COPY it (press Comand + C)

Select a folder (or anything you want to change the icon of) and Right-click on this folder, bringing up the info pane. Go up to the top of the pane, click once on the icon to highlight it, and PASTE.

You now have your new icon.

Preview does more than just preview with some new features in Leopard.

You can manipulate images and documents with features such as colour adjustments, easy cropping, removing backgrounds or areas with the select tool and more.

You can merge PDF’s and use the more advanced annotation and notes features. Fire up Preview and see whats possible. Do you have any tricks for “Preview”?
